- A segment from a Season 1 episode of the public TV series "David Holt's State of Music."
The public TV series "David Holt's State of Music" is distributed nationally by PBS.
Full episodes can be streamed at www.pbs.org/pro...
The series premiered on UNC-TV and is presented by Nashville Public Television.
